Storytimes are free and no
registration is required. All storytimes are designed with
age-appropriate activities that include books, music, nursery rhymes
and fingerplays.

R.E.A.D. Club
A book
discussion group for kids in 4th and 5th grade. The books will be
available for check out when you register. Registration begins at
each meeting for the next meeting. Kids should read the book before
the group meets and arrive ready to discuss the book, eat yummy
snacks and go on a scavenger hunt! The group meets one Tuesday
a month from
